Although Prince Harry may have attained a reputation for mischief and shenanigans, he nonetheless remained adored as royalty in the UK, and is viewed as a celebrity worldwide.
Born on 15 September 1984, in at St Mary’s Hospital, Paddington, London, England, he was christened Henry Charles Albert David on 21 December later that year. Friends, family and even staff at Kensington Palace grew accustomed to referring to Prince Henry as Harry, and it became normal to do likewise in the media, so as Prince Harry he became known to the world.
Following his christening at St George’s Chapel, Windsor Castle, Princess Diana and Prince Charles took Harry on his first royal tour in 1985, visiting Italy. Harry again accompanied the royal family during their visit to Canada in 1991, and also in 1998 after Diana’s unfortunate passing.
Like the other men in his family, Prince Harry attended independent schools, though following his mother’s wishes, Harry also gained exposure to worldly influences such as visits to Disney World and places like HIV Clinics.
It was Diana’s hope that both Prince William and Prince Harry gain broader experiences of the real world, and have a better understanding than previous generations of royal children. Sadly, in 1996 Diana passed away, one of several passengers involved in a car accident in Paris; at the time, Prince Harry was eleven years old.

At just 12 years old in 2017, Allie Sherlock became an internet sensation when her cover of Ed Sheeran’s “Supermarket Flowers” went viral. Allie, a now teenage girl from Cork City, Ireland, quickly gained fans from all over the world. Currently, the video has over 13 million views on her YouTube, and keeps attracting more views and comments from fans all over the world.
In the same year, she performed at the Miss Universe Ireland pageant, and went on to audition for “Britain’s Got Talent,” proceeding to the second round before elimination. Her viral video of busking on the streets of Dublin caught the attention of Ellen DeGeneres, and secured her an invitation for an appearance, performance and interview on “The Ellen DeGeneres Show”. Since then, Allie has amassed a large following on social media, with over almost six million subscribers and over a billion views of all her videos on YouTube, and more than two million followers on Instagram.
Born in April 2005 in Cork City, Ireland, Allie Sherlock was always destined to be a singer. As a child, she enjoyed singing at home, and would beg her father to take her out busking. Allie lost her mother when she was just nine years old, and during her saddest moments, she used music to cope with the loss. In the same year, she set up a YouTube channel, and began busking on the streets of Dublin when her father gave in, after years of Allie begging to showcase her musical prowess on the streets of her city. Finally, under her father’s watch, with her signature mellow and soulful voice, Allie pulled large crowds who surrounded her as she performed.

Orange County Choppers was a multi-million-dollar customized motorcycle-building business empire, established in 1999 by Paul Teutul Sr. along with his son Paul Jr.. A reality-television series about them called “American Chopper” premiered in 2003, catapulting them to fame such that many chopper-style motorcycle enthusiasts, from regular folks to high-profile celebrities, wanted to commission a bike from their shop. For a time, the Teutuls lived the American dream, until they bit-off more than they could chew, and the company was forced to liquidate its assets. One of them was the Orange County Choppers headquarters, which was valued at $13 million when they built it, but sold for just $2.3 million, a mere fraction of its original cost.
The fascination with chopper-style motorcycles was almost gone by the 1970s, but was resurrected when Jesse James came into the picture with his West Coast Choppers crew - some bike builders tried to be cool or snooty about it, but the Teutuls belonged to the group that credited Jesse’s contribution for its renewed popularity. As Orange County Choppers drew inspiration from that, coupled with hard work, skill and relentless drive, the small business they had started in their basement became a successful customization company. It didn’t take long for the Teutuls to become one of the world’s top custom motorcycle builders.
Paul Teutul Sr. was a self-confessed late bloomer when it came to riding motorcycles. Back in the day, there were few bike riders going around in his community, and were even called rare creatures. It was only when he reached the age of 20, and after watching the movie “Easy Rider” in 1969, that he developed an interest in building one.

William Sanford ‘Bill’ Nye is an American television host, science advocate, and mechanical engineer, who rose to fame during the mid-‘90s as the presenter of the beloved television show “Bill Nye The Science Guy”.
Bill also gained popular appeal with his vast number of fans and followers through appearances on numerous other media platforms, which included the comedy series “The Big Bang Theory”, “Dancing With The Stars” and many more, as well as the release of the Netflix series “Bill Nye Saves the world”.
What few people know about Bill though, is that the wacky scientist is also a first-rate comedian, who gained his first exposure on television in the comedy sketch show “Almost Live!”, which subsequently inspired the creation of his popular show “Bill Nye The Science Guy”.
Since the cancellation of his first project, Bill certainly hasn’t disappeared off the face of the planet, and has continued to advocate the importance of science, while pursuing a rather successful career in entertainment.
Following the final episodes of “Bill Nye The Science Guy”, William went on to inspire numerous media focused on popularising many sciences, which includes mathematics in the crime drama series “Numb3rs”. Aside from playing a motivational role, Bill also began working on several other projects, though none have proven to be as popular as the original series.
Bill is also known for having written two books, both focused on scientific endeavours taking a look at modern problems and potential scientific solutions, which inspired the 2017 Netflix adaptation of Bill’s initial success with “Bill Nye Saves The World”.

The pilot episode of “The New Yankee Workshop” was filmed in 1989, and featured Abram building a replica of a 17th-century Massachusetts saltbox house. The episode was well-received, and the proposed series was soon picked up by the Public Broadcasting Service (PBS) for a full season.
The show quickly became a hit, with audiences captivated by Abram's affable personality and laidback manner which endeared him to viewers, as well as step-by-step instructions and explanations of various carpentry techniques. He showcased the art of woodworking through a variety of projects, from functional workshop accessories to intricate reproductions of antique furniture.
Spanning 21 seasons, the program featured a total of 235 different builds. Alongside indoor furniture and cabinetry, the show also delved into outdoor constructions, including a picturesque gazebo, a functional shed, a verdant greenhouse, a sleek sailing boat, a stately flagpole, a charming mailbox, a decorative cupola, and sturdy fences. In addition, the host often toured locations of great significance to woodworking, bringing the very essence of the craft closer than ever to the average household.
One of the hallmarks of the series was its use of state-of-the-art technology and tools. Abram and his team utilized cutting-edge equipment, such as computer-aided design software and high-tech saws to create precise and accurate projects.

In 2016, a 12-year-old girl walked onto the stage in the first episode of the 10th season of “Britain’s Got Talent” to audition for the show. Happy that she had earned an audition after having her application to the show turned down the previous year, the young girl gave a few nervous responses to Simon Cowell, then launched into an electrifying performance of “Defying Gravity” from “Wicked -The Musical”.
Her performance had the audience rising in awe, and all four judges on their feet, giving her a standing ovation. At one time during the performance, the angelic voice had Amanda Holden’s skin breaking out in goosebumps - at the end of the performance, Amanda sent the already excited crowd into a frenzy by pressing the Golden Buzzer, marking the moment that launched the British singer Beau Dermott to stardom.
From the moment Beau belted out the first note in her performance, she was a star! She defied the live audience’s, judges’, hosts’, and viewers’ expectations with the level of control she had over her voice, and her ability to hold notes for just the appropriate amount of time. She earned praise and admiration for her ability to adapt her facial expressions to match the notes and lyrics, and ended her performance expertly by holding the last note for a few seconds before ending it abruptly. Beau became an instant favorite in the season, and rode the wave of her newly-found popularity to the spot Amanda Holden’s Golden Buzzer secured her in the final round.
